Output 2880aba8ec2c656c9e46b944dfdc09a72bf1566a8d1af5faa1dcd6bcdfd176dc:0

value
663036
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48815b1c3b6c67a03d03bc30b44984fd27425846 OP_EQUALVERIFY OP_CHECKSIG
address
17cNccoTEZnG56PwWdHXZyrk79Npqw4VDQ
transaction
2880aba8ec2c656c9e46b944dfdc09a72bf1566a8d1af5faa1dcd6bcdfd176dc
confirmations
364491
spent
true